AllBright saved as assets acquired following administration
Deal News | Feb 03, 2025 | Business Cloud

Women-only members club AllBright has been rescued from administration by an investee company of London-based real estate firm Cain International. Previously valued at £100m in 2019, AllBright faced recent financial challenges, leading to the closure of its Mayfair townhouse. The assets have now been acquired, and members will relocate to a new co-hosted residence at Old Sessions House in Farringdon, which offers various amenities. Cain International plans to implement a strategic model emphasizing learning, networking, and events. This includes opening a permanent AllBright Lounge next month. The acquisition marks a significant moment for AllBright, which aims to continue empowering women and supporting business growth. Former co-founders Anna Jones and Debbie Wosskow OBE expressed surprise at the closure but hope the community will persevere. AllBright plans to maintain its focus on fostering opportunities for connection and growth among women, including through its AllBright Alliance that partners with Fortune 500 companies.
